GDX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

760 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in VanEck Gold Miners ETF (GDX)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$7.11B — up 22% from $5.84B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 149 funds opened new GDX positions and 77 closed out — a net gain of 72 holders — while 254 added to existing stakes and 193 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bessemer Group, adding an estimated $210M. The largest seller was Susquehanna International Group, cutting an estimated $420M.
